The OCEANIE Sheep Petrol Bison from Daytona isn’t just another leather jacket—it’s a reimagined piece of history. Inspired by the iconic A2 flight jacket worn by WWII pilots, this model takes the classic silhouette and infuses it with modern tailoring and bold design details. The result? A blouson that feels both timeless and fresh, perfect for those who appreciate quality manufacturing with a story.
Sheep leather is known for its softness and lightweight feel, making it an ideal choice for a jacket that’s meant to be worn often and comfortably. Unlike heavier cowhide, this material drapes naturally, moulding to your movements while maintaining a sleek profile. The petrol bison colour—a deep, muted tone with warm undertones—adds a vintage touch that only improves with age, developing a unique patina over time.
The slim cut of this jacket is designed to enhance the silhouette without feeling restrictive. It’s tailored enough to look sharp over a shirt or jumper, yet roomy enough to layer over a lightweight knit when the temperature drops. The ribbed cuffs and hem ensure a snug fit, keeping the cold out while adding a sporty contrast to the smooth leather.
Daytona hasn’t just recreated the A2—it’s given it a modern twist. The long axial zip, shirt-style collar, and functional pockets—including a zipped sleeve pocket—balance practicality with style. Meanwhile, the brand’s logo on the right sleeve adds a touch of authenticity, reminding you of the quality manufacturing behind the piece.
This isn’t a jacket you’ll wear once and forget. Its medium weight makes it suitable for spring and autumn, while layering can extend its use into winter. Pair it with raw denim and boots for a rugged look, or throw it over a roll-neck and tailored trousers for something more refined. The petrol bison colour works with everything from earthy neutrals to bold hues, making it a wardrobe staple that adapts to your mood.
Daytona has carved out a niche in the leather jacket world by blending classic designs with contemporary twists. The brand draws inspiration from vintage military and aviation styles—think A2 bombers, MA-1s, and racing jackets—but updates them with modern fits, premium leathers, and thoughtful details. Each piece is crafted to tell a story, whether through subtle historical references or bold design choices. Daytona’s jackets aren’t just outerwear; they’re investments in style, built to last and evolve with the wearer.

This jacket is made from sheep leather, known for its softness and lightweight feel. It offers a smooth texture and excellent drape, making it comfortable to wear while maintaining durability.
The slim fit is more tailored, closely following the body’s contours without being restrictive. It offers a modern silhouette compared to a regular fit, which tends to be looser and more relaxed.
Sheep leather has some natural elasticity, so it may stretch slightly with wear, particularly around areas like the shoulders and elbows. However, it retains its shape well if properly cared for.
The ribbed cuffs and hem provide a snug fit, helping to retain warmth and prevent cold air from entering. They also add a structured finish to the jacket’s design.
Yes, sheep leather is breathable and lightweight, making this jacket suitable for transitional seasons like spring and autumn. It can also be layered over lighter garments in cooler summer evenings.
Regularly clean the leather with a damp cloth to remove dust. Use a leather conditioner every few months to keep it supple and prevent drying or cracking. Avoid exposing it to excessive moisture or direct sunlight.
The jacket features a long axial metal zipper and other metal hardware, which are designed for durability. However, like all metal components, they should be handled with care to avoid snagging or misalignment.
